deuslovelt의 등록된 링크

 deuslovelt로 등록된 네이버 블로그 포스트 수는 25건입니다.

About Me [내부링크]

학력 성균관대학교 반도체시스템공학과 4학기 재학 경력/활동 반도체 교내 시스템 관리실 회장 백준 ...

2022 KAKAO BLIND 1차 코테 해설 [내부링크]

저번과 같이 카카오 코테를 간단히 해설하려고 한다. 필자는 1시간50분 정도 남기고 올솔을 했다. 개인적으...

2021 카카오 인턴십 코테 리뷰 [내부링크]

6월에 재미 삼아 카카오 코테를 보고 직후에 바로 디시에 해설 글을 적었었는데 요새 문제가 프로그래머스...

UCPC2021 후기 [내부링크]

8월 14일 날 열린 UCPC 본선에서 11위라는 좋은 성적으로 5등상을 수상하였다. 뉴비들의 유쾌한 반란 ...

2021 신촌지역 대학생 프로그래밍 대회 동아리 연합 겨울 대회 (SUAPC 2021 Winter) Open Contest 후기 [내부링크]

최근에는 오픈 콘테스트도 있을 때 마다 참가하는 편인데 아마 지금 까지 본 오픈 콘테스트 중 가장 잘 본 ...

Codeforces Round #705 (Div. 2) 후기 [내부링크]

https://codeforces.com/contest/1493 드디어 퍼플을 도달한 것 같다. 열심히해서 침팬치 레벨까지 도달할 ...

Codeforces Round #712 (Div. 2) virtual 후기 [내부링크]

최근에는 밤에 있는 코포나 앳코더 대회는 참여하지 않으려한다. 생활 패턴이 깨져서 다음 날에 영향이 가...

구글 킥스타트 Round B 2021 후기 [내부링크]

아침 8시부터 열려서 꾸역꾸역 참가를 했다. 생각보다는 잘 본 것 같지만 C 마지막을 못풀어서 100점을 못...

bitmask를 이용한 bfs 최적화 [내부링크]

얼마전 백준에서 문제를 풀다가 완전그래프에 가까운 그래프에서 bfs를 어떻게 하면 빠르게 돌릴 수 있을까...

Codeforces Round #727 (Div. 2) 후기 [내부링크]

대회 시간대가 저녁이라 편하게 보았다. E,F 가 대회중에 푼 사람이 두 자리수 였어서 전형적인 스피드셋...

2021 구글 킥스타트 Round D 후기 [내부링크]

이번 라운드는 4-2 마지막 문제를 제외하고는 문제가 좀 쉬웠던 감이 있다. 빨리 풀어서 등수가 잘 나온 것...

Codeforces Round #702 (Div. 3) virtual 후기 [내부링크]

https://codeforces.com/contest/1490 최근에 설날이라 집에 내려가서 쉬느라 대회를 3개 안 뛰었는데굉장...

Codeforces Round #704 (Div. 2) 후기 [내부링크]

처음으로 레드 퍼포먼스를 찍어봤다.시스텟이 굉장히 많이 터졌던 라운드라 그런 것 같다.E번의 경우 도...

Codeforces Round #697 (Div. 3) virtual 후기 [내부링크]

div3 에 버츄얼 난이도이긴 하지만 처음으로 올솔을 해봐서 기쁘다.플레급에 해당하는 문제가 하나도 없...

Codeforces Round #698 (Div. 2) 후기 [내부링크]

https://codeforces.com/contest/1478아쉬움이 많이 남는 라운드이다.조금만 더 집중해서 대회중에 D를 ...

Codeforces Round #694 (Div. 2) 후기 [내부링크]

요즘 못 풀겠는 문제가 많아 자신감이 떨어져 점수가 낮은 계정으로 대회를 보았다.C번까지 어렵지 않았...

ps 블로그 시작 [내부링크]

학교를 휴학하고 2021년에는 ps 에 올인문제를 정리하는 공간이 있으면 좋을 것 같아문제에 대한 풀이나 생각을 이곳에 올리고자 함.

CF#691 - Div 2(virtual) [내부링크]

오랜만에 뛰는 코포라 감이 많이 떨어진 것 같다.B번도 너무 오래걸렸고 C는 이상한 접근 방법만 떠올리다 끝나버려서 D번은 쳐다도 못봄 https://codeforces.com/contest/1459/problem/A한 카드에 두 수가 적혀있고 카드를 배열했을때위쪽과 아래쪽의 값의 크기가 큰 쪽이 이긴다면이길 확률이 높은 쪽을 선택하는 문제이다.위아래가 같은 값을 가진 카드만 N장 있다면 어떻게 배치해도 비길 수 밖에 없음이때 한장을 위쪽 값이 크도록 바꾸면 위쪽 플레이어가 이기게 되고만약 N-2 카드는 값이 같고 나머지 두장은 각각 한쪽이 큰 카드라면 이때는 큰 카드가 앞쪽에 있는플레이어가 승리한다 당연히 이 확률은 같으므로 draw이다.즉 값이.......

BOJ 2651 / 자동차경주대회 [내부링크]

https://www.acmicpc.net/problem/2651딱봐도 dp 스러운 문제인데dp를 잘하지 못해서인지 다익스트라 쪽으로 푸는 풀이가 바로 떠올라시작점 정비소 끝점을 노드로 하고거리상 가능한(두 노드 간 거리가 최대 주행 거리를 넘지 않는) 노드에정비소 비용을 가중치로 하는 간선을 그어 다익스트라를 돌렸다.

CF-div2 edu 100(virtual) [내부링크]

https://codeforces.com/contest/1463오늘도 코포 버츄얼을 하나 돌렸는데 아침부터 배가 아파서 조졌문제가 잘 안풀렸다B번에서 접근이 너무 느렸다.<소스 코드>https://github.com/ohsolution/HPS/tree/main/CodeForce/div2_edu-100https://codeforces.com/contest/1463/problem/A전형적인 A번 문제이고7의 배수 번째 공격 때 모든 몬스터의 피가 1,1,1 이면 된다.진짜 멍청하게 a+b+c -3 에 6을 모듈러 쳤다.당연히 7번째 공격 때 전범위로 공격하는 걸 고려해줘야 하므로6 3 6 3 ... 이런식으로 공격이 이루어지기 때문에9로 모듈러 했을때 6이 나오면 OK 다,단 몬스터가 마지막 공격 때 죽어야 하므로 a,b,c 가 먼저 죽는 경.......

RunningMedian 알고리즘 [내부링크]

사실 알고리즘이라고 하기도 뭐한데전체 set 에 값이 추가되거나 삭제될 때 중앙값을 바로 찾을 수 있는 방법이다.이번 SCPC 2차 예선 B번이 이러한 유형의 문제였다.펜윅트리나 세그트리를 이용해도 이 유형의 문제를 풀 수 있지만이 쪽이 조금 더 간단하긴 하다.이 방법의 기본적인 아이디어는 이렇다두개의 힙(또는 균형이진트리)을 이용해서 전체 값들 중 낮은 값 절반을 내림차순으로 한 쪽에 두고높은 값 절반을 반대편 힙에 오름차순으로 둔다.즉 낮은값들은 최대힙에 높은값은 최소힙에 담는다.그렇다면 중앙값은 항상 최대힙의 top에 위치할 것이므로 바로 알 수 있다.숫자들이 무작위로 들어올 때 이러한 구조를 어떻게 계속 유.......

Knapsack [내부링크]

얼마전 코포 문제에서 냅색을 못한다고 느껴서오늘 knapsack 태그 문제만 풀고있다.물론 dp로 풀리는 knapsack 을 얘기하고 있다.dp는 메모리와 시간을 치환하는 기법이라 생각한다.문제를 푸는 입장에서 보자면 냅색문제는 어떤 정수값의 범위가 메모리에 올리기 좋아보이게 나온다.https://www.acmicpc.net/problem/1472812865,17845 와 동일한가장 기본적인 knapsack 문제이다. 시간 값을 메모리에 올린 후 각 시간에 점수 최댓값을 dp로 계산하면 된다.이때 값이 오염되지 않도록 뒤에서 부터 돌린다.https://www.acmicpc.net/problem/13350데이터 하나에 경우가 세가지 나오는데* 우리팀이 무조건 이기는 경우* 적팀이 무조건 이.......

Codeforces#692 - div2(virtual) [내부링크]

https://codeforces.com/contest/1465/problem/AA번은 간단한 구현 문제였다.(여기서도 끝을 잘못 잡아서 시간 딜레이가 있었다.)https://codeforces.com/contest/1465/problem/BB번은 대회 시간 내에 해법을 떠올리지 못했다.스코어보드를 보고 생각보다 많이 풀려서 풀이가 간단할 거라 생각했고믿음의 for문을 그냥 돌려볼까도 생각했지만 이유가 마땅치 않아서 그냥 넘겼었다.생각해보면 숫자가 바뀜에 따라 자릿수마다 숫자가 바뀌어 버려서 이렇게 핸들할려면 무리가있다.대회가 끝나고 생각해보니 1부터 9까지 최소공배수를 구하면 얼마 안되지 않나 싶었다.계산해보면 2520이 나오는데 결국 최악의 경우에도 2520 번안에 무조건 조.......

2020 천하제일 코딩대회 Open Contest 후기 [내부링크]

요즘은 백준에 올라오는 오픈 콘테스트도 매번 참가중이다.오늘 선린고 코딩대회인 천하제일 코딩대회 오픈 콘테스트를 봤고간략하게 문제를 정리하려고 한다.< 소스코드 >https://github.com/ohsolution/HPS/tree/main/OpenContest/2020%EC%B2%9C%ED%95%98%EC%A0%9C%EC%9D%BC%EC%BD%94%EB%94%A9%EB%8C%80%ED%9A%8CPA 부터 PD 까지는 간단한 구현문제였는데PB,PD 에서 딜레이가 있었다.PB번 문제에서 if문을 중복해서 쓰는 부분에서 문법 상 오류가 있었고PD번 문제에서 가능한 인덱스를 찾을때 시간 조건 상 이분 탐색으로 찾았어야 했는데최소 최대 인덱스 처리 방식이 좀 달라서 lower_bound 와 upper_bound를 쓰는 부분에서 딜레이.......

Codeforces Good Bye 2020 후기 [내부링크]

어제 밤에 커피를 마시면서 사이클을 깨면서 까지 good bye 2020 을 보게 되었다.e번까지 1시간 30분 안에 끝내고 f번이 1시간 30분 남았었는데.문제를 디스크립션 부터 이해하기가 힘들어서 결국 시간내에 풀어내지 못했다.a번 부터 e번 까지 간략하게 정리하자!https://github.com/ohsolution/HPS/tree/main/CodeForce/goodbye2020A. Bovine Dilemma a 번은 간단한 구현문제 였다.0,1 점과 x축의 두점으로 만드는 삼각형의 넓이로 나올 수 있는 모든 경우를 세면 된다.n이 작으므로 이중포문으로 밑변의 길이를 set 에 넣는 방식으로 해결한다.문제 디스크립션에서 non zero area 를 구해야 한다는 설명이 있는데삼각형이 일직선 상의.......